One of the things about this study is that a lot of baby and toddler books are written in house, by editors. So the study reveals the whiteness of editorial in kidlit even if not explicitly. But, big picture, this trend is unacceptable. I remember so many promises www.theguardian.com/books/2025/o...
‘Catastrophic decline’ in Black representation in children’s books
A report by charity Inclusive Books for Children found that of the 2,721 books surveyed, only 51 featured a Black main character, down by 21.5% since 2023

This month is the 56th anniversary of the #TV #anime Sazae-san, running weekly since 5 October 1969, the longest-running animated TV show in the world. Midori Kato holds the record for the longest career as the voice of a single character. Last year's celebrations: soranews24.com/2024/11/19/s...
Sazae-san breaks own Guinness World Records again for 55 years on television
Star voice actor is 85 going on 25.

The "polluter pays" principle is often ignored (eg with the environmental costs of #AI) but in this case it would prevent far greater costs and health risks from hitting communities and consumers all over the world.
helenmccarthy51.bsky.social
Invasive species have a massive impact on agriculture (and hence good prices) as well as disease control and the natural and built environment. Requiring shipping companies and ports to sanitise all containers would add to distribution costs but minimise much greater costs from species incursion.
